The West Point Housing Authority (WPHA) is currently accepting Public Housing waiting list applications for families and senior/disabled individuals.The WPHA offers one Public Housing community with 190 units for families and senior/disabled individuals.To apply, visit the WPHA to pick up an application, located at 805 Ivy Lane, West Point, MS 39773, between the hours of 7:00 am until 4:00 pm, Monday-Friday.Once the application has been completed, it must be hand delivered to the address listed above. No documents are needed at this time.The WPHA does have a list of all preferences on the front page of the application.More information can be found by visiting the WPHA website at http://www.westpointhousingauthority.com/, or by calling 662-495-2004, between the hours of 7:00 am until 4:00 pm, Monday-Friday.
Applicants who need help completing the application due to disability can make a reasonable accommodation request to the housing authority via (662)495-2004.
